Найти значение (p-значение) каждого компонента в разделении дисперсии, используя r? - PullRequest
0 голосов
/ 09 марта 2020

Я запустил анализ разделения дисперсии, используя r, и мне нужно найти значение значимости (p-значение) для каждого компонента в ResultTable?

Вот коды, которые я использовал до сих пор:

#first make 4 tables of explanatory variables
Nutrients=c("DIN","DRP")
Sediments=c("SIS","SOS")
Habitat=c("RHA")
thevarpart = varpart(Y = All.data[, "MCI"], 
                 log10(All.data[, Nutrients]), 
                 All.data[,Sediments],
                 All.data[,Habitat])
x11(); plot(thevarpart, cutoff = 0, digits = 
1,bg=c("hotpink","skyblue","yellow"),Xnames=c('Nutrients','Fine Sediment','Habitat'))
x11(); showvarparts(3,bg=c("hotpink","skyblue","yellow"))
ResultsTable <- rbind.data.frame(thevarpart$part$fract, thevarpart$part$indfract); ResultsTable

Мои данные выглядят так:

MCI SIS SOS DIN DRP RHA
118 282.5595    23.90908052 0.0335  0.002   60
90  315.9466376 32.12509173 0.675   0.006   55
97  573.8064879 71.16698102 0.9655  0.026   53.5
119 123.8694668 28.89448716 0.03    0.002   72
120 39.27030208 9.465458598 0.0175  0.002   71
97.5    475.0791544 103.2212162 0.915   0.0145  52
120 588.576473  107.5916448 0.21    0.01    80.5
101 319.4977937 45.97594364 0.465   0.0045  48.5
89  615.1995445 85.89353893 0.6475  0.0105  53
120 349.7319968 28.82643698 1.546   0.002   70.5
102 381.8583689 44.76326487 0.078   0.004   51
87  656.9546267 87.62515067 3.62    0.032   49.5
97  1186.128223 116.1077253 0.7205  0.012   48.5
83  330.235734  32.63877857 1.1915  0.014   51
106 121.9643987 12.22626485 0.385   0.002   63.5
99  528.7900893 24.33578253 0.93    0.006   51
90  1546.765404 126.9419995 0.915   0.0085  56
115 625.869261  31.09234308 0.37    0.005   59.5
97  516.7899503 70.82898363 0.815   0.011   48.5
121 446.7218383 116.7642469 0.1585  0.011   83
74  1245.867382 151.7759208 0.302   0.071   48.5
100 641.1141972 81.31781456 1.0575  0.007   58
93  518.8630661 86.74102689 0.51    0.009   49
119.5   170.5972465 15.07056712 0.63    0.002   61
117 80.33983969 10.6866821  0.038   0.002   55
98  541.6111975 56.74776662 0.972   0.005   61
101 600.0329388 68.70973658 0.832   0.0095  58
95  784.6798499 116.2767808 0.919   0.0235  53.5
100 1071.666097 108.9452369 1.0485  0.021   47
83  1385.849876 112.2573191 2.11    0.029   47
78  796.8454586 99.79436559 1.531   0.036   41
75  1573.820802 196.5013325 1.568   0.0275  37
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...